Reason for recall

Jolly Rancher product is recalled due to undeclared soy lecithin.

  1. - Recall initiated
  2. - Reported by source
  3. - Recall terminated
Recalled products
Product description UPC Quantity Lot / code information
Jolly Rancher product is hard candies, individually wrapped in flexible plastic wrap, and package in plastic bag. Net weight 2 oz or 4.5 oz. UPC on the 4.5 oz. bag: 7 09972 80101 0. The label of the retail bag is read in parts: INGREDIENTS: CORN SYRUP, SUGAR, CONTAINS 2% OR LESS OF, MALIC ACID, NATURAL AND ARTIFICIAL FLAVOR, ARTIFICIAL COLOR (RED 40, BLUE 3, YELLOW 5, YELLOW 6), SULFUR DIOXIDE, TO MAINTAIN FRESHNESS *** MAY CONTAIN: PEANUTS***SOY*** Product of USA *** Werner Gourmet Meat Snacks Inc. Tillamook, OR 97141 *** www.wernerjerky.com ***. Not published in this source record 2076 cases (12/2 oz. packages per case) and 7199 cases (6/4.5 oz. packages per case) Best by: 01 NOV 2019 through Best by: 01 JAN 2021.

Distribution

  • distributed nationwide and in Canada.

Frequently asked questions

What does a Class II mean?

A situation in which use of or exposure to a product may cause temporary or medically reversible adverse health consequences, or where the probability of serious consequences is remote.
